Understanding the Need for Digital Integration in Catering Services

The traditional catering model, often reliant on manual bookings, paper menus, and face-to-face communication, is becoming obsolete in the face of modern expectations. Data from industry research highlights that over 65% of catering clients prefer to handle their event planning and ordering via digital interfaces (Source: Industry Insights 2023), signaling a clear shift towards integrated, seamless technology solutions.

Key benefits of digital integration include:

  • Enhanced efficiency: Automating reservations and order processing reduces human error and speeds up provisioning.
  • Personalized user experience: Digital platforms allow customization options that cater to individual client preferences.
  • Real-time communication: Instant updates and notifications improve coordination and customer satisfaction.

Leading catering services are investing heavily in custom apps and online portals to meet these expectations, effectively transforming the digital customer journey into one that mimics the fluidity of modern mobile apps.

The Role of Mobile Applications in Modern Catering

Mobile applications serve as the central hub for customer engagement, order management, and service customization. They bridge the gap between service providers and clients, creating an environment where users can effortlessly plan, modify, and track their catering needs from anywhere — akin to using a native app on a smartphone.

However, not all apps are created equal. A truly effective catering app must integrate several core features:

Feature Description Industry Example
User-Friendly Interface Intuitive design that simplifies navigation for users of all tech levels. Apple’s Food & Drink Apps
Real-Time Updates Instant communication regarding order status, menu changes, or special requests. UberEats Delivery Tracking
Personalization & Preferences Customized menus, dietary restrictions, and event details stored for future use. Starbucks Mobile Order & Pay
Seamless Payment Integration Multiple payment options supporting swift checkout experiences. PayPal, Apple Pay in food apps

These features collectively foster loyalty, reduce planning friction, and position catering businesses as forward-thinking service providers.

Industry Insights and Future Outlook

The catering sector’s digital evolution aligns with broader trends across hospitality and foodservice industries, emphasizing app-like responsiveness and personalization. According to recent surveys (2023 Food Service Technology Report), over 78% of users expect their digital interactions to mirror native app experiences, underscoring the importance of intuitive design and seamless integration.

Emerging advancements, such as voice-command ordering, AI-driven recommendations, and augmented reality menus, suggest that the future of catering will be increasingly immersed in digital innovation. Businesses that proactively adopt these technologies will position themselves as industry leaders and trusted partners in their clients’ memorable events.
